WebNov 2, 2024 · Terahertz (THz) frequencies remain among the least utilized in the electromagnetic spectrum, largely due to the lack of powerful and compact sources. The … WebTerahertz quantum cascade lasers QCLs are an emer-gent compact source of narrowband terahertz radiation in the wavelength range of 60–350 m 5–0.85 THz .1 In order to achieve lasing, the laser mode requires strong confinement within the active region.
